The Amazing Tale of a Twice-Married Monkey Astronaut
When Peruvian-born, U.S.-raised astronaut Miss Baker died in 1984 at the age of 27, she had been to space once and married twice. Her grave, located at the United States Space and Rocket Center in Huntsville, Alabama, sits alongside those of her first husband, George, and her second husband, Norman. Atop Miss Baker’s headstone sits a pile of bananas, each one placed by an admirer. They make a fitting tribute to a fallen pioneer: Like any other squirrel monkey, Miss Baker loved bananas.
